According to industry reports, the job market for radiologic technologists is expected to grow by 9% from 2020 to 2030, which is faster than the average for all occupations. This growth translates to a wealth of job opportunities for graduates, allowing them to choose from diverse work environments and specialties. Graduating from H Councill Trenholm State Community College not only positions you favorably in this expanding job market but also enhances your earning potential.

Radiologic technologists can expect to earn a competitive salary. The median annual wage for radiologic technologists was approximately $63,710 in 2021, with the potential for higher earnings as you gain experience and pursue advanced certifications.
